FOR DECADES, we EDUCATED the 5-paragraph essay to my personal ninth-graders. And I also is great at it.

In my opinion one need I coached they for way too long got as it got all I actually knew as a teacher. Seriously, instructor prep training dont generally speaking do a good job at teaching authorship instruction. We visited the college of Pennsylvania for my personal scholar program, although We discovered a lot about training as a whole, two practices tuition arent adequate to train anyone about what it surely ways to become an author or to train composing to others. As a, newer instructor, we welcomed the structurea€”yes, the rigidnessa€”that the 5-paragraph essay offered. In the end, I experienced other items to bother with, like reading most of the courses I experienced to show and controlling a classroom of skeptical teenagers.

The 5-paragraph essay was also more straightforward to rank. Its much simpler to evaluate if a students article satisfies a template as opposed to means each scholar essay as its very own distinctive write-up, with its own-form, framework, function, and sound. AND THUS ITS WITH PUBLISHING . For a long period, I used a band-aid method to train publishing. When youngsters had problems adhering to the 5-paragraph framework, I scaffolded my training to really make it more relaxing for these to stick to. I developed more handouts, even more step-by-step directions, additional layouts. Match your a few ideas into this fill-in-the-blank, we encouraged them. No surprise whenever I started to teach 11th and twelfth quality children that they battled with writing and thinking beyond what the instructor needed. They used the teacher to tell them what direction to go and how to get it done. And generally, they created writing that fit the criteria I outlined. I was the sufferer of my very own achievement.

A common discussion when it comes to 5-paragraph article is it may be a useful tool for college students to organize her a few ideas.

We do not disagree that students need apparatus. We need help whenever we are discovering something, particularly things as intricate as publishing. But there are some issues with this method. One, more youngsters never ever go beyond this solitary tool. To counteract this, we determine ourselves that really just train other types of writing alongside the 5-paragraph essay.

This tip, however, has not considered straight to me personally. It appears as though a damage: better keep your 5-paragraph article and merely put other sorts of publishing. Exactly what seems like compromise merely considerably worka€”more services doing something that 1) might ineffective, and 2) the majority of coaches simply do not have time doing. Used, we focus on the 5-paragraph article and if we’ve got enough time (which we never ever do), we tell our selves better teach other forms of publishing (which we really do not).

Then theres this argument: Students cant actually perform the 5-paragraph article, just how do they really do other types of publishing? This reason assumes that 5-paragraph essay was a prerequisite to more complicated kinds of publishing. I would personally argue that it’s just not. Actually, i might believe there are numerous those who go on to research paper writing help be skilled authors without learning the 5-paragraph type (We me is never ever coached because of this). If any such thing, I would arguea€”as other people bring contended here, here, right here, here, here, and right herea€”that the 5-paragraph article actually inhibits composing development for a lot of most college students which support.

Heres a good example. Just a couple of years ago, while I had been knee deep in teaching the 5-paragraph article, an associate advised that I provide youngsters the chance to decide their particular information, to create their particular thesis comments instead of creating essays as a result toward prompts Id currently created. I was thinking about this but determined against it. Exactly Why? Because whenever Id given them preference prior to now, youngsters would develop subject areas that did not conveniently fit into the 5-paragraph and recommended thesis report structure. What they wanted to arguea€”however complex, genuine, or interesting it could bring beena€”didnt compliment the design.

But this procedure try exactly the reverse of exactly what should take place. Youngsters information should determine the proper execution, perhaps not the other means around. I additionally wonder if we inadvertently set pupils experiencing creating at an even greater disadvantage by withholding more complex types of creating until they have mastered a not-so-complex layout.
